Fuel Type Comparisons for Dual Fuel Generators
Dual fuel generators can operate on both propane and gasoline, giving users flexibility in fuel choice. Each fuel type has its unique characteristics that affect performance, storage, and maintenance. Knowing these differences can help you select the best fuel for your needs.
Propane is a clean-burning fuel that produces fewer emissions compared to gasoline. This can lead to less wear and tear on the generator’s engine. Gasoline, on the other hand, is widely available and typically provides more power per gallon.
Propane vs Gasoline Performance Factors
When considering a dual fuel generator, understanding the performance differences between propane and gasoline is crucial. Each fuel type offers unique advantages and challenges that can significantly impact efficiency, power output, and overall usability. This section delves into the key performance factors that differentiate propane from gasoline, helping you make an informed choice for your energy needs.
When evaluating performance, consider the following factors:
-
Power Output: Gasoline generally provides higher wattage than propane.
-
Efficiency: Propane burns more efficiently, leading to longer run times.
-
Cold Weather Performance: Gasoline may perform better in colder temperatures.
-
Emissions: Propane produces fewer pollutants, making it more environmentally friendly.
| Fuel Type | Power Output (W) | Efficiency (Hours/Gallon) | Emissions Level |
|---|---|---|---|
| Propane | 8,000 | 10 | Low |
| Gasoline | 9,500 | 7 | Moderate |

Fuel-Specific Maintenance for Generators
Understanding the maintenance requirements for dual fuel generators is essential for optimal performance. The type of fuel used—propane or gasoline—can significantly impact the upkeep needed to ensure longevity and efficiency. This section delves into the specific maintenance tasks associated with each fuel type, helping users make informed decisions for their generator care.
Maintenance needs differ based on the fuel used.
-
Propane Maintenance: Requires regular checks on the tank and connections to prevent leaks. Less frequent oil changes are necessary due to cleaner combustion.
-
Gasoline Maintenance: More frequent oil changes and fuel system cleaning are needed due to carbon buildup.
Propane and Gasoline Safety Guidelines
When using a dual fuel generator, understanding the safety guidelines for both propane and gasoline is essential. Each fuel type presents unique risks and handling procedures that users must follow to ensure safe operation. This section outlines critical safety practices to keep in mind when working with these fuels.
Safety is paramount when using either fuel type.
-
Propane Safety: Proper ventilation is essential to prevent gas buildup. Ensure tanks are stored upright and away from heat sources.
-
Gasoline Safety: Store in approved containers and keep away from ignition sources to avoid fire hazards.
